What are HVAC Coils and Blowers?

HVAC coils and blowers are two of the most important components in your home's heating and cooling system. The coil is responsible for the actual heating or cooling of the air, while the blower moves that air throughout your home.

The Role of the Coil in Heating and Cooling

The HVAC coil is where the magic happens in terms of temperature change. There are two main types: the evaporator coil and the condenser coil. The evaporator coil is located inside your home, usually within the air handler or attached to your furnace. It absorbs heat from the air in your home, cooling it down. In contrast, the condenser coil is located outside in the outdoor unit. It releases the heat that was absorbed by the evaporator coil. Without these coils, your air conditioner or heat pump simply wouldn't be able to do its job.

The Role of the Blower in Airflow

The blower's job is to move air across the coil and then circulate that conditioned air throughout your home's ductwork. It's essentially a large fan powered by a motor. The blower pulls air from your home through return vents, pushes it across the coil to be heated or cooled, and then sends it back out through your supply vents. A properly functioning blower is essential for even temperature distribution and overall comfort.

Why Coil and Blower Matching Matters

Matching your coil and blower is critical for optimal performance and efficiency. If the coil and blower aren't properly matched, you could experience a number of problems, including reduced cooling or heating capacity, increased energy bills, and even premature failure of components. An incorrectly sized blower can put extra strain on the coil, leading to leaks or other damage. When selecting a new system, make sure the coil and blower are designed to work together.

Types of HVAC Coils A Homeowner's Guide

While the basic function of HVAC coils is the same, there are different types available. These include:

  • A-Coils: These are the most common type, named for their A-shape. They offer a good balance of surface area and airflow.
  • Slab Coils: These are flat and rectangular. They are often used in older systems or in situations where space is limited.
  • Microchannel Coils: These are a newer technology that uses a series of small channels to improve heat transfer. They are often more efficient than traditional coils.

The type of coil you need will depend on your specific system and needs. When in doubt, consult with a qualified HVAC technician.

Types of HVAC Blowers ECM vs. Standard

There are two main types of HVAC blowers: standard blowers and ECM (Electronically Commutated Motor) blowers. Standard blowers operate at a fixed speed, while ECM blowers can adjust their speed based on the heating and cooling demand. ECM blowers offer several advantages, including:

  • Improved Energy Efficiency: ECM blowers use significantly less energy than standard blowers, which can lower your utility bills.
  • More Consistent Airflow: ECM blowers can maintain a more consistent airflow, even when the ductwork is restrictive.
  • Quieter Operation: ECM blowers are generally quieter than standard blowers.

Signs You Need a New Coil or Blower

Knowing when to replace your coil or blower can save you money and prevent major system failures. Here are some common signs that it's time for a replacement:

  • Reduced Cooling or Heating Performance: If your system isn't keeping your home as comfortable as it used to, it could be a sign of a failing coil or blower.
  • Unusual Noises: Strange noises coming from your HVAC unit, such as banging, rattling, or squealing, could indicate a problem with the blower motor or coil.
  • Increased Energy Bills: A sudden spike in your energy bills without a change in usage could be a sign that your system is working harder to compensate for a failing component.
  • Visible Damage: Inspect the coil for signs of corrosion, leaks, or physical damage. Check the blower for worn belts or damaged fan blades.

If you notice any of these signs, it's best to have your system inspected by a qualified HVAC technician.

Maintenance Tips for Optimal Coil and Blower Performance

Proper maintenance is essential for prolonging the life of your HVAC coil and blower and ensuring optimal performance. Here are some tips:

  • Regularly Change Your Air Filter: A dirty air filter restricts airflow, which can put extra strain on the blower motor and cause the coil to ice up. I recommend changing your filter every 1-3 months, depending on the type of filter and the air quality in your home.
  • Keep the Outdoor Unit Clean: Remove any debris, such as leaves, grass clippings, and branches, from around the outdoor unit. This will ensure proper airflow and prevent the coil from overheating.
  • Schedule Regular Professional Maintenance: Have your HVAC system inspected and tuned up by a qualified technician at least once a year. They can clean the coil, check the refrigerant levels, and identify any potential problems before they become major issues.

Frequently Asked Questions

What is the purpose of the HVAC coil?

The HVAC coil, whether it's the evaporator coil or the condenser coil, plays a key role in the heat transfer process. The evaporator coil absorbs heat from the air inside your house, providing cooling. The condenser coil releases the heat outside. This is how both cooling and heating (in heat pump systems) work.

What does the blower motor do in an HVAC system?

The blower motor's job is to circulate air all through your house. It forces air across the coil, which heats or cools it, and then sends that air through your ductwork and vents.

How do I know if my HVAC coil is failing?

If your HVAC coil is failing, you might see things like reduced cooling or heating, refrigerant leaks, ice buildup on the coil, or strange noises from your HVAC unit. To be sure, have a professional take a look.

What are the benefits of an ECM blower motor?

ECM (Electronically Commutated Motor) blowers use less energy than standard blower motors. They can change speeds, which means more consistent airflow and better comfort. They can also save you money on your energy bills.

How often should I have my HVAC coil cleaned?

I usually recommend having your HVAC coil cleaned by a professional at least once a year. Cleaning it regularly helps it work its best, saves energy, and prevents problems down the road.
